Emulsifiers are molecules have both polar and nonpolar parts and thus are capable of dissolving in or interacting with both lipids and water. When emulsifiers are mixed with lipids and water, they may act to suspend small droplets of the lipid in water.

Web1 nov. 2011 · Lipids are important components in bread making as they provide a variety of beneficial properties during processing and storage which reflects their overall diversity. In bread, lipids originate from multiple ingredients. The three main sources of lipids in a typical bread formula are wheat flour, shortening and surfactants ( Table 1 ).
